#d0b25d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0b25d is composed of 81.6% red, 69.8%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.4% magenta, 55.3%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 44.3 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 59%. #d0b25d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ffba with #a16500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#d0b25d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0b25d has RGB values of R:208, G:178,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.55,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13677149.

Shades and Tints of #d0b25d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050402 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f5 is the lightest one.
